Philippine President Ferdinand Marcos Jr. put his own SWF on ice after facing opposition. The Maharlika Investment Fund was signed into law in July and it appeared to be a priority for Marcos. The Office of Executive Secretary said Marcos held up to “study carefully” how the fund would be organized and managed, and to…
